Abstract
We have analyzed the types of mutations induced by glyoxal, a major ox idative DNA-damage product, in Salmonella typhimurium. A set of six st rains, TA7001 to TA7006, was used to detect base-pair substitutions, a nd the TA98 strain was employed to detect frameshift mutations. Glyoxa l did not induce mutations at A:T base pairs. The majority of the muta tions induced by glyoxal were base-pair substitutions at G:C base pair s, and a small level of frameshift mutations was detected in the TA98 strain.
